minigli

minigli is a tiny command argument parser for Go.

Usage

minigli.Pack() returns MiniGli (and error check bool).

type MiniGli struct {
	Cmd	string           // Command 
	Subs	[]string         // Sub Commands 
	Longs	map[string]string// Options start with "--"
	Shorts	map[string]string// Options start with "-"
}
  • Options are key-value pair given with 1 or 2 "-"s.
  • Commands are the rest.
  • Cmd is the first of Commands
  • Subs are the rest.

e.g)

// your-cli verb target --option value -another:value target2
mg, ok := minigli.Pack()
if !ok {
    // Handle Invalid Argument.
    // Only "invalid option" occurs invalid argument.
    // "invalid option" will be explained later.
}

mg.Cmd // "verb"
mg.Subs// ["target", "target2"]
mg.Longs// {"option" : "value"}
mg.Shorts//{"another": "value"}

Options rule

Long option can be specified as below:

  • --option value
  • --option:value
  • --option=value

Short option is same.

Key only option is specified like this:

  • --opt:
  • -opts=

Only last of arguments can be key only option withou ":" or "=".

Next are invalid options and Pack() fails to parse then returns false.

  • --:SomeString
  • -:ThisIsToo
